Ortona Park is a single-family neighborhood in south Ormond Beach, Volusia County (ZIP 32174), positioned north-west of the Ortona area and near the Holly Hill line and the Halifax River. It is an established, walkable residential neighborhood rather than a gated or amenity-driven community.
The MLS subdivision label Ortona Park Sec 01 refers to a recorded plat section of the broader Ortona Park neighborhood. Homes are established single-family residences of varied era and condition on quiet, tree-lined streets.
The neighborhood is valued by residents for its peaceful, walkable feel, nearby parks and restaurants, river proximity, and central location, with US-1, downtown Ormond, downtown Daytona, and the beach all within a manageable distance.
Because Ortona Park is an established, older neighborhood, the purchase is about the individual home, its roof, systems, and condition, and the lot, compared against the closest similar sale rather than a neighborhood-wide average.
